Behavior
It lives in groups and the colony number may go up to sixty bats. It spends the day taking shelter and roosting in trees, caves or buildings, so it means that it’s a nocturnal species. They tend to return to the same roosting spot every day. After feeding they usually groom themselves before approaching others.
